Coat-wise, first round of pattern drafting is done. I've gotta transfer the patterns for the front and the sleeves to fabric so I can do a test-fit (my main concerns are if the front closes like it's supposed to, and if the sleeves and armholes give me enough range-of-motion to be practical), and from there, I'll make adjustments (I strongly suspect the sleeves are where I'll need to do the most work) and go from there. I need about eight yards of fabric for the main body of the coat, and if I can, I'll just use my mockup as the lining except for the sleeves, which will need a satin-like fabric for ease of putting on and taking off.
I've got the warmth layer bought and ready to go, though I think I'll need to get another quilt padding thing or two, just to be safe. I'm gonna try and get material that's waterproof, 'cause I'm not sure I have enough beeswax to waterproof the entire exterior of the coat.
